Overview
Bailieu was founded in 2012 and is headquartered in Australia, while Direct FX was established in 2006 and is based in New Zealand. Bailieu holds licences including Australian Securities and Investment Commission (ASIC), while Direct FX is regulated by Unregulated among others. Bailieu serves 10,000+ clients worldwide; Direct FX has 10,000+. The minimum deposit is $10000 at Bailieu and $1 at Direct FX.

Fees
Fees are a critical factor when choosing between Bailieu and Direct FX, directly affecting your bottom line as a trader. Direct FX has a lower barrier to entry with a minimum deposit of $1 (vs $10000 at Bailieu). Neither broker charges withdrawal fees. Direct FX charges deposit fees; Bailieu does not. Overall, Direct FX scores higher on fees in our assessment.

Platforms
Bailieu offers MT5, cTrader, while Direct FX supports MT4, MT5, cTrader. Both brokers provide mobile trading apps for iOS and Android. Direct FX supports social and copy trading features, which Bailieu does not offer. Direct FX edges ahead on platform breadth and functionality in our scoring.
